Live Well Now is an interactive anti-aging plan that can almost guarantee you a longer, healthier and more fulfilling life. In fact, Dr. Demko's plan is so innovative that he created a new word Youth'n ™ just to describe it:. The book provides a simple, easy-to-follow strategy that slows the aging process. You will find out just what works and what doesn't, and discover the anti-aging benefits of dozens of simple lifestyle modifications like:
- Eating a daily serving of oatmeal or oatbran
- Having friends that are a variety of different ages
- Reducing your daily caloric intake by twenty percent
- Having a religious or spiritual connection

About The Author
David Demko, PhD is a gerontologist, an expert on aging. Demko is a lifestyle columnist for Blender's Maxim Magazine and his work has been featured in Marie Claire and Glamour. He has appeared on London's BBC radio, Sony Television's nationally syndicated, daily talk show Life & Style, and is frequently quoted in leading newspapers and magazines throughout the US, including Forbes Magazine and the NY Times.
The University of Michigan graduate, who is a professor at Miami Dade College, served two White House commissions under President Ronald Reagan and President George Bush, Sr. Professor Demko's contributions to the field of aging include publications in both academic and mass media, as well as coining new gerontological terms including The Death Calculator and Youth'n.
